ViewCast.com, Inc. develops industrial hardware and software through Niagara Streaming Media and Osprey business. The company is headquartered in Shady Shores, Texas. ViewCast’s Niagara streaming appliances and Osprey video capture cards provide the technology required to deliver the multi-platform experiences driving today’s digital media market. The firm markets and sells its products and services directly to end-users or through indirect channels, including original equipment manufacturers (OEMs), value-added resellers (VARs), resellers, distributors and computer system integrators. ViewCast markets and sells its products and services across the world. The Company’s wholly owned subsidiaries include VideoWare, Inc., Osprey Technologies, Inc., ViewCast Solutions, Inc. p/k/a Ancept Corporation and ViewCast Technology Services Corporation.
